x/4 + 1 = -6

I'm not sure the process to solve the equation, could I have help?

x/4 + 1 = -6

Subtract 1 from both sides.

x/4 = -7

Multiply both sides by 4

x = -28

Of course! I'd be happy to help you solve the equation. To do so, we'll follow a series of steps:

Step 1: Isolate the variable term
Start by subtracting 1 from both sides of the equation. This will eliminate the constant term on the left side, leaving only the variable term on that side.

x/4 = -7

Step 2: Solve for the variable
To solve for x, we need to get rid of the fraction. Multiply both sides of the equation by 4 to cancel out the fraction on the left side.

4 * (x/4) = 4 * (-7)
x = -28

Step 3: Check your solution
To confirm that your solution is correct, substitute the value of x back into the original equation and see if it holds true.

(-28)/4 + 1 = -6
-7 + 1 = -6
-6 = -6

Since both sides of the equation are equal, we can conclude that x = -28 is the solution.

In summary, to solve the equation x/4 + 1 = -6, you isolate the variable term by subtracting 1 from both sides, then solve for the variable by multiplying both sides by the denominator of the fraction. Finally, you check your solution by substituting it back into the original equation.
